Over the previous decade, Twilio SendGrid has embraced Transport Layer Safety (TLS) encryption to guard outbound emails as these journey between servers.
In a digital world rife with cyberattacks, implementing true end-to-end e mail encryption for delicate emails has change into more and more obligatory.
However what precisely does this imply? This publish supplies an summary of what end-to-end encryption is and the forms of surveillance it protects.
Bulk vs. focused surveillance
Easy Mail Switch Protocol (SMTP) with TLS protects knowledge in movement. So if you submit an e mail to SendGrid utilizing TLS, we encrypt it because it travels out of your mail server to our mail servers. We then try and ship it to your recipients over a TLS-encrypted connection. If their mail server helps TLS, we’ll ship an encrypted model of your e mail, guaranteeing that passive surveillance units will solely see ciphertext.
This technique is efficient in opposition to passive bulk surveillance methods—just like the Nationwide Safety Company faucet at AT&T’s spine facility. Nonetheless, a decided attacker who has the technical means may carry out a focused man-in-the-middle assault on the TLS connection. With their very own certificates and key, the hacker can decrypt the ciphertext and seize the content material earlier than reencrypting it and forwarding it to the authentic vacation spot server.
As cyberattackers proceed to evolve their strategies, it’s essential to develop options that counter their extra aggressive approaches—whether or not by Java-encrypted e mail or different methods.
Finish-to-end e mail encryption
To defeat energetic assaults in opposition to SSL and TLS, customers can implement end-to-end or data-at-rest e mail encryption utilizing languages like PHP or Java.
Public key encryption options for e mail have been round for the reason that Nineties. The primary profitable implementation was Fairly Good Privateness (PGP), created by Philip R. Zimmermann again in 1991.
PGP was the focus of the crypto wars (that’s brief for encryption, not cryptocurrency). At one level, Zimmerman famously printed the supply code as a hardback e-book through MIT press and distributed it below First Modification protections. Nonetheless, PGP by no means actually noticed industrial success, maybe as a result of the expertise was too arduous to make use of. The GNU Privateness Guard (GPG) is a substitute for PGP accessible below Basic Public License.
One other sort of end-to-end encryption is Safe/Multipurpose Web Mail Extensions (S/MIME), an ordinary for public key encryption developed in 2004. S/MIME leverages X.509 certificates as a substitute of PGP keys. Whereas comparatively obscure, well-liked mail purchasers like Outlook, Mail App, and Thunderbird have supported it for years—so long as you might have the proper third-party plugins put in. Apple has additionally supported S/MIME encrypted e mail on iPhones/iPads since 2012, with the discharge of iOS 5.
One main critique of S/MIME is that its safety mannequin relies on trusting public certificates authorities, which have suffered severe compromises that undermine the entire system. In reality, the general public key infrastructure (PKI) on which the whole web relies upon is simply as sturdy as its weakest hyperlink.
Though this subject could transcend the scope of this weblog publish, it’s essential to notice your browser relies on the general public PKI. So for most individuals, S/MIME and publicly trusted certificates ought to present affordable safety.
In the event you consider that you simply’re topic to focused surveillance and wish end-to-end e mail encryption, you possibly can nonetheless realistically use S/MIME with self-signed certificates. Nonetheless, you must confirm the certificates fingerprints for the events you talk with out of band, identical to you’ll confirm PGP key fingerprints.
Learn extra concerning the several types of encryption in our e mail encryption FAQ.
Google and end-to-end encryption
It’s essential to notice that regardless of including sections to its Transparency Report to handle e mail safety issues, Google doesn’t provide true end-to-end e mail encryption. Google’s TLS encryption ensures that nobody’s taking a look at your e mail en route from level A to level B. Nonetheless, it doesn’t assure that the message will stay personal as soon as it reaches the vacation spot server. In reality, Google scans your inbox to energy its good options and flag suspected spam.
Moreover, Google solely helps S/MIME encryption if the sender and receiver use paid Google Workspace Suite accounts and change safety keys throughout preliminary configuration. Whereas Google has talked about end-to-end encryption since 2014, it has made little progress. Presently, the one strategy to get that stage of safety is to depend upon third-party service suppliers to bridge the hole.
Ship safe emails with Twilio SendGrid
Now that you realize a bit about PGP/GPG and S/MIME, which one would you select? As we talked about above, Outlook, Thunderbird, Mail App, and iPhone/iPad have native help for S/MIME. We will stroll you thru the setup course of in our publish titled Finish-to-Finish Encryption With S/MIME.
To study extra about securing your outbound emails, take a look at Tips on how to Ship a Safe Electronic mail for Entry and Supply. Then, if you’re prepared to begin sending safe emails, strive Twilio SendGrid at no cost.